Job description

This is a remote position.

  • Assist attorneys in preparing legal documents such as contracts, pleadings, and briefs
  • Conduct legal research and gather relevant information for case preparation
  • Organize and maintain legal files and documents
  • Coordinate case filings, court schedules, and deadlines
  • Draft correspondence and communicate with clients, courts, and third parties
  • Maintain and update case management systems and databases
  • Support the legal team in trial preparation and administrative tasks 

Requirements

  • Bachelor’s degree or certification in Paralegal Studies or a related field
  • Minimum of 1 year of paralegal or legal assistant experience
  • Strong understanding of legal terminology, court procedures, and documentation
  • Excellent organizational and time-management skills
  • Exceptional attention to detail and accuracy
  • Proficiency in MS Office and legal management software (e.g., Clio, MyCase, etc.)
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ills
